Package Contents
Be sure all items listed here were included with your camera. Memory cards are sold separately. · D700 digital camera (pg. 3) · Body cap (pp. 36, 388) · BM-9 LCD monitor cover (pg. 21)
· MH-18a quick · EN-EL3e charger with rechargeable power cable Li-ion battery with (pg. 32) terminal cover (pp. 32, 34)
· AN-D700 strap (pg. 21)
· EG-D100 video cable (pg. 255)
· UC-E4 USB cable (pp. 238, 245)
· BS-1 accessory shoe cover (pg. 377)
· Warranty · User's Manual (this guide) · Quick Guide · Software Installation Guide
· Software Suite CD-ROM · Registration card (U. S. A. only)
